Output 5885830ead56e64b51c520dc45293fe562638970322bfadb2e1ca1d0068d4499:0

value
342588
script pubkey
OP_0 OP_PUSHBYTES_20 3abf6d97144e42d068b68bd58ebcaf737717953f
address
bc1q82lkm9c5fepdq69k302ca090wdm309fltsrlvs
transaction
5885830ead56e64b51c520dc45293fe562638970322bfadb2e1ca1d0068d4499